## Vexalune Environments: Session-Token Refresh Bug

Plugin authors should be aware of a token refresh defect affecting the staging and sandbox environments of Vexalune. Tokens issued before the hourly rotation window were not invalidated, so plugins occasionally held stale sessions for up to ninety minutes. The fix ships in the current staging build; production is unaffected. If your plugin caches tokens, clear the cache after the next rollout. The configuration each environment now uses for refresh behavior is listed below.

settings of fafog-haduf:
ZORIX_PIN=4648
ZORIX_METRICS_HOST=metrics.zorix.paliqsys.corp
ZORIX_LOG_LEVEL=info
ZORIX_TENANT=druix

## Break-Glass Access: Autocomplete Index Rebuilds

Plugin authors targeting the Quillmere suggestion engine should know the autocomplete index can lag badly during bulk imports. Do not trigger manual rebuilds yourself; request break-glass access through the Fennick escalation queue instead. Approved requests receive a time-boxed token for the rebuild console. When the console's sealed maintenance prompt appears, enter the recovery passphrase shown immediately below this line.

vault phrase of tajeg-tageg = pelix-druix-holius-briael-zorwyn-frawyn-fraox-norok-drueth-aldiel

Welcome to the Lumenbridge consent team. This quarter we're rolling out the new consent banner across all Pinewood-hosted properties. The banner config ships as a signed bundle; the edge nodes reject anything unsigned, so every deploy must be stamped before upload. Rollout happens in three waves, starting with the staging ring. Before your first deploy, add the team signing key to your local keychain. The key you need is below.

rollout seal: bky4_x7Gc

Runbook: Health checks behind the Maraview load balancer. Each Quillhost node exposes /healthz, which must return 200 within 500 ms or the balancer drains it. During a release, expect brief flapping while new pods warm caches; do not roll back unless more than two nodes stay drained for five minutes. Confirm the active pool matches the intended release before sign-off. The deploy token for the verified rollout appears directly below this line.

pipeline stamp: htk31_f769b577b3028a4e9958e5bb8d1259a